About This Item

New York: Stein & Day, 1965. First American edition. Hardcover. Fine/good. First American edition. Hardcover. 84 pp. Fine in dust jacket with fade to the spine as well as a 1 1/2 inch chip to the foot of the spine. Play set in 16th century Peru that portrays the conflic tof two world through the characters Attahullapa the Incan and Spanish conquistador Juan Pizzaro. The play was critically accalimed and well received by audiences both in London where it premiered and on Broadway where in 1965 it ran for 261 performances.
